What is Double Glazing?
Double glazing refers to a window or door building and construction method that incorporates 2 panes of glass with an area between them. This area is typically filled with air or an inert gas like argon, which helps improve thermal insulation. The primary objective behind double glazing is to develop a barrier that lessens heat loss and noise infiltration, making homes more energy-efficient and comfy.

Advantages of Quality Double Glazing
Energy Efficiency
- Among the most substantial benefits of quality double glazing is energy performance. By creating an insulating barrier, double-glazed windows can considerably reduce heating expenses. Homeowners often report savings of as much as 20% on their energy costs.
Noise Reduction
- Quality double glazing offers an effective soundproofing service, specifically useful for homes found near busy roads or noisy environments. The multiple layers of glass take in sound waves, making sure a serene indoor environment.
Security Enhancement
- Invest in double-glazed windows for included home security. The robust construction makes it more difficult for trespassers to break in, providing peace of mind for house owners.
Condensation Reduction
- Double glazing lessens condensation build-up on windows throughout temperature level variations, lowering the danger of mold development and benefiting individuals with allergies or respiratory problems.
Increased Property Value
- Residences equipped with energy-efficient features, consisting of double glazing, are typically more appealing to prospective purchasers. This can result in an increase in property worth.
Setup Process of Double Glazing
Step 1: Initial Assessment
- An expert installer assesses the home to make sure that double glazing is an appropriate alternative based on factors such as existing window frames and structure.
Step 2: Choosing the Right Windows
- Property owners need to choose quality frames and glazing alternatives. Typical materials for frames consist of uPVC, wood, and aluminum.
Action 3: Measurements and Planning
- Accurate measurements are crucial for a seamless fit. The installer will measure existing windows and prepare the setup accordingly.
Step 4: Installation
- The installers will remove old windows (if relevant) and fit the new double-glazed units. Care is taken to guarantee appropriate sealing to prevent air leakage.
Step 5: Final Inspection
- After setup, a last assessment makes sure that whatever is sealed properly and working as it should.
Table 2: Types of Glazing Options
| Type | Description |
|---|---|
| Low-E Glass | Shows heat, keeping homes warm in winter. |
| Laminated Glass | Increases security and sound insulation. |
| Gas-Filled Units | Argon or krypton-filled for enhanced insulation. |
| Tinted Glass | Decreases glare and safeguards furnishings from UV rays. |
Costs of Double Glazing
The expense of double glazing differs based on numerous aspects, including:
- Type of Glazing: Different glazing choices have various rate points. Low-E glass and gas-filled alternatives tend to be more expensive.
- Size of Windows: Larger windows require more products and are typically costlier.
- Frame Material: uPVC frames are typically less expensive than hardwood or aluminum frames.
- Setup Complexity: Additional difficulties, like customized styles or structural modifications, can increase costs.
Typical Cost Estimates:
- uPVC Double Glazed Windows: ₤ 300 - ₤ 700 per window
- Wood Double Glazed Windows: ₤ 800 - ₤ 1,500 per window
- Aluminum Double Glazed Windows: ₤ 600 - ₤ 1,200 per window
Bear in mind that while the initial financial investment might be high, quality double glazing can lead to significant savings in time due to reduced energy expenses.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How long does double glazing last?
Quality double glazing normally lasts around 20-35 years, depending on the materials used and maintenance practices.
2. Is double glazing worth the financial investment?
Yes, double glazing deserves the investment due to its energy efficiency, noise decrease abilities, and increased home worth.

4. Will double glazing reduce my energy bills?
Yes, homeowners can see obvious reductions in energy costs due to improved insulation and minimized heat loss.
5. Are there grants offered for double glazing installations?
In some areas, there might be federal government grants or rewards for energy-efficient home improvements. Inspect local regulations and programs.
